2. Key Hardware Terms: Pronunciation Practice | 关键硬件术语:发音练习

Start with the basics: components like monitor, keyboard, CPU, and motherboard. Practice saying them aloud. For example, ‘monitor’ is pronounced /’mɒnɪtə/ (MON-i-ter).

从基础学起:如显示器、键盘、中央处理器和主板等组件。大声练习它们的发音。例如’monitor’读作/’mɒnɪtə/ (MON-i-ter)。

You can use a table to review the most common hardware vocabulary with their phonetic spellings and Chinese meanings.

你可以使用表格来复习最常见的硬件词汇及其音标拼写和中文含义。

English Term Pronunciation Guide 中文
Central Processing Unit (CPU) /siː piː juː/ 中央处理器
Random Access Memory (RAM) /ræm/ 随机存取存储器
Hard Disk Drive (HDD) /eɪtʃ diː diː/ 硬盘驱动器
Solid State Drive (SSD) /es es diː/ 固态硬盘
Input devices /’ɪnpʊt dɪ’vaɪsɪz/ 输入设备
Output devices /’aʊtpʊt dɪ’vaɪsɪz/ 输出设备

Repeat these words daily until you can say them naturally. Listen to native speakers pronouncing them online to improve your accent.

每天重复这些词,直到你能自然地念出。在线听母语者发音以改善口音。

4. Coding Vocabulary for Beginners | 初学者编程词汇

In Year 7, you likely use block-based coding or simple text-based languages. Master the pronunciation of ‘algorithm’, ‘sequence’, ‘loop’, and ‘variable’. ‘Algorithm’ is /’ælɡərɪðəm/.

在七年级,你可能使用积木式编程或简单的文本语言。掌握’algorithm’、’sequence’、’loop’和’variable’的发音。’Algorithm’读作/’ælɡərɪðəm/。

Being able to say ‘This loop repeats ten times’ clearly is important for oral assessments.

能够清楚地说出”This loop repeats ten times”对于口语评估很重要。


5. Listening: Following Classroom Instructions | 听力:遵循课堂指令

Teachers often give step-by-step directions like ‘Create a new Python file’, ‘Click on the green flag’, or ‘Drag the sprite to the left’. You need to understand these quickly.

老师经常给出逐步指导,如”Create a new Python file”、”Click on the green flag”或”Drag the sprite to the left”。你需要快速理解这些。

Practice by listening to coding tutorial videos without subtitles first, then check your understanding. Write down keywords you hear.

先尝试不看字幕听编程教程视频,然后检查理解程度。写下听到的关键词。


6. Listening Comprehension: Identifying Key Information | 听力理解:识别关键信息

During a listening task, focus on verbs like ‘select’, ‘delete’, ‘copy’, ‘paste’, and ‘run’. These indicate actions you must perform.

在听力任务中,注意像’select’、’delete’、’copy’、’paste’和’run’这样的动词。它们指示你必须执行的操作。

Listen for numbers and sequence words such as ‘first’, ‘then’, ‘after that’, ‘finally’. They structure the instructions.

注意听数字及顺序词,如’first’、’then’、’after that’、’finally’。它们构建了指令结构。


7. Oral Description: Explaining a Project | 口语描述:介绍项目

You may be asked to describe a Scratch game or a simple app you built. Prepare a short speech: ‘My project is a maze game. The player moves a cat using arrow keys. If the cat touches the walls, it goes back to the start.’

你可能会被要求描述一个Scratch游戏或你制作的简单应用。准备一段简短的发言:”My project is a maze game. The player moves a cat using arrow keys. If the cat touches the walls, it goes back to the start.”

Focus on clear pronunciation of game elements: ‘sprite’, ‘backdrop’, ‘costume’. Practice until you can speak without hesitation.

注重游戏元素的清晰发音:’sprite’、’backdrop’、’costume’。练习直到你能够毫不犹豫地表达。

9. Common Q&A in Oral Assessments | 口语评估中常见问答

Expect questions like: ‘What does this block do?’, ‘Why did you use a forever loop?’, ‘Can you explain how you debugged your program?’

预期问题如:”What does this block do?”、”Why did you use a forever loop?”、”Can you explain how you debugged your program?”

Practice answering in full sentences: ‘This block waits until the space key is pressed, then it starts the animation.’

练习用完整句子回答:”This block waits until the space key is pressed, then it starts the animation.”


10. Mock Oral Exam Practice | 模拟口语考试练习

Record yourself explaining how to change a sprite’s size or how to write a simple if-else statement. Listen for clarity and correct any mispronunciations.

录下自己解释如何更改角色大小或如何编写一个简单的if-else语句。注意清晰度并纠正任何发音错误。

Ask a friend or family member to give you random computer-related instructions to test your listening. For example: ‘Open the web browser, go to scratch.mit.edu, and start a new project.’

请朋友或家人随机给出与计算机相关的指令来测试你的听力。例如:”Open the web browser, go to scratch.mit.edu, and start a new project.”
